The Bachelor of Design belongs to the Faculty of Arts, Design & Architecture (ADA) at UNSW Sydney, which encompasses more than 80 study areas across Built Environment, Humanities and Social Sciences, Education, Design, Media and Fine Arts.
UNSW Arts, Design & Architecture operates across the Kensington and Paddington campuses, both of which are built on Aboriginal Lands of the Bidjigal and Gadigal peoples.
Students have access to a range of support services including The Nucleus: Student Hub, UNSW Support Services, Wellbeing & mental health support, ADA Equity, Diversity & Inclusion Support, peer mentoring, ADA Creative spaces, and academic skills support including myPlan for degree planning and academic resources.
Yes, UNSW ADA offers ADA Work Integrated Learning and UNSW Employability programs, as well as placements and internships, to help students build career-ready skills and connect with industry professionals.
UNSW has 9 subjects ranked in the top 5 in Australia according to the QS World University Rankings by Subject 2026, and is ranked #33 in the world for Architecture and Built Environment, which is closely related to the Design discipline.
